Screening Scholarship Media Festival - Submissions Open Until 10/15
*camra*, a media pedagogy lab, at UPenn's Graduate School of Education & Annenberg School of Communication is holding it's 2nd Annual Screening Scholarship Media Festival (#SSMF2014) and are still accepting submissions. *camra* seeks to push the boundaries of research and media, developing new ways of knowing through audiovisual forms of expression and create an aesthetic sensibility that destabilizes previously held notions of what differentiates art from scholarship. Thus, the festival asks participants to consider the following questions: - *What are the possibilities that advances in media offer for knowledge production? * - *What are the methods and strategies that media makers and academics share in their work?* - * What are the ways in which academics can and should integrate rigorous media production in their research?* Last year we had a range of submissions from artists, filmmakers, scholars, educators, designers and more. They shared films, e-books, online multimodal publications, animations and other amazing media work. SUBMISSIONS DUE ON 10/15/13.
